Color-wise this is a vivid, dark teal leaning cool. It builds a smooth gradient with Rlm 66 (1938) underneath and Rlm 70 on the highlights, all in the AK Interactive line. Substitutes are thinner on the ground; Vallejo Turquoise is the nearest same-finish option at 85 percent, with 2 brands in strong-match range. Any substitute is a mixing base rather than a drop-in, so tune it on the model.
Turquoise equivalents and near misses
Fair warning: nothing matches AK Interactive Turquoise cleanly. The options below are the least bad, and every one of them drifts.
Closest Vallejo equivalent: Vallejo Turquoise, close, with a hint of drift side by side (delta E 3.0).
Best Green Stuff World option: Green Stuff World Arachnid Green, a near match with visible drift up close (delta E 3.9).
From The Army Painter: The Army Painter Deep Azure, a usable stand-in rather than a twin (delta E 4.3).
Citadel's closest color: Citadel Sons of Horus Green, workable at tabletop distance, not up close (delta E 4.6).
Check it on a spare model first, because Vallejo Turquoise sits slightly darker than the original and the difference grows over large flat panels.

What is the closest equivalent to AK Interactive Turquoise?
The closest same-finish match is Vallejo Turquoise at 85% color similarity.
What color is Turquoise?
Turquoise is a dark vivid teal with a cool undertone (hex #004A4D).
What do I highlight and shade Turquoise with?
Highlight Turquoise toward Rlm 70 and shade it down into Rlm 66 (1938), both AK Interactive paints in the same finish family.
